Australian Election: Where Do Candidates Stand on Housing?

MARKET SOLUTIONSGOVERNMENT INTERVENTION

Positions

David Littleproud
David Littleproud"[W]e will work with all levels of government to remove hurdles to drive more home building in regional communities."Apr 23, 2025
Peter Dutton
Peter Dutton"We will also invest $5 billion in essential infrastructure — like roads, power, water and sewerage — unlocking 500,000 new homes and helping more Australians into a home sooner."Apr 24, 2025
Peter Dutton
Peter Dutton"A Coalition Government will allow you to deduct interest payments on the first $650,000 of a mortgage against your taxable income."Apr 13, 2025
Anthony Albanese
Anthony Albanese"Labor will invest $10 billion to build 100,000 new homes reserved for first home buyers only."Apr 24, 2025
Adam Bandt
Adam Bandt"Investors don’t need tax handouts to help them buy their 7th, 12th or 200th property while people struggle to buy their first. It really is that simple. We urgently need to reform these unfair tax handouts."Apr 24, 2025
Adam Bandt
Adam Bandt"The Greens ... want rent caps because unlimited rent increases should be illegal."Apr 24, 2025
Anthony Albanese
Anthony AlbaneseLabor will "[p]rovide $120 million from the National Productivity Fund to incentivise states to remove red tape and help more homes be built faster."Apr 24, 2025
Peter Dutton
Peter DuttonThe Liberals will "[i]mplement a two-year ban on foreign investors and temporary residents purchasing existing homes in Australia."Jan 15, 2025
Peter Dutton
Peter Dutton"We’ll reduce international student numbers and cut permanent migration by 25%, freeing up nearly 40,000 homes in the first year alone."Apr 24, 2025
Adam Bandt
Adam BandtThe Greens will "[p]rovide 70% of the homes as rentals capped at 25% of household income or 70% of market rent, whichever is lower, saving renters up to $16,600 annually."Apr 02, 2025
Anthony Albanese
Anthony AlbaneseLabor will "[e]xpand the Help to Buy program to help first home buyers by lifting the property price and income caps to make the scheme more accessible."Apr 24, 2025
Adam Bandt
Adam BandtThe Greens will "[d]eliver 610,000 affordable homes over the next decade by establishing a federally owned public property developer to rent and sell homes below market prices."Apr 02, 2025
Anthony Albanese
Anthony Albanese"[U]nder a Labor government, you will be able to buy your first home with just a five per cent deposit."Apr 14, 2025
Anthony Albanese
Anthony Albanese"We do need to do more to build housing, but that is what we are doing."Apr 24, 2025
Adam Bandt
Adam Bandt"We want to see big fines for real estate agents and property investors who break the law, including by refusing to do repairs."Apr 24, 2025
Anthony Albanese
Anthony AlbaneseLabor will "[i]ntroduce a 2-year ban on foreign investors buying existing homes."Apr 24, 2025
Peter Dutton
Peter DuttonThe Liberals will "[r]estore the Australian Building and Construction Commission to tackle union corruption that has contributed to driving up building costs by up to 30 per cent."Jan 15, 2025
Peter Dutton
Peter Dutton"[W]e will allow first home buyers to access up to $50,000 of their super towards a deposit."Apr 24, 2025
Adam Bandt
Adam BandtThe Greens will "[m]ake unlimited rent increases illegal, by freezing rents for two years then capping rent increases long term at 2% every 2 years, saving renters thousands each year."Apr 02, 2025
